Output 596b34fa63d8befe2adf0ae9bb4c515a61a691dc14882fb1efd33d83c94965e2:1

value
1469000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c4ffaeb265eee7b56adde1705753b0e7cc04401 OP_EQUAL
address
38eX6EwVPAvZZmDwHPHaWq1mP56vMpDRLz
transaction
596b34fa63d8befe2adf0ae9bb4c515a61a691dc14882fb1efd33d83c94965e2
spent
true